OpenWRT on Pine64 PineDio LoRa GW

This fork add support for the Pine64 PineDio LoRa Gateway in OpenWRT. This fork is based on OpenWRT 23.05.05.

The following changes are needed for the LoRa Packet Forwarder to run and connect to The Things Network:

  • PATCH Edit the DTS file to enable SPI0 and UART2. Those peripherals are needed to communicate with the LoRa module and its GPS.
  • Modify the package sx1302_hal to build the packet_forwarder application and to fix 2 issues
    • Makefile Disable the temperature sensor which does not seems to be available on our board (to be confirmed)
    • PATCH Move a big buffer from the stach to the heap to avoid a SEFGAULT (the size of the stack on OpenWRT is probably smaller than on regular Linux OS).

How to build

Follow the original instructions from OpenWRT. The only additional step consists in copying .config_pine64_pinedio_lora_gw into .config to ensure that all options and settings are correctly applied to work with the LoRa gateway.

git clone git@github.com:JF002/openwrt.git -b pinedio-lora-gw
cd openwrt
./scripts/feeds update -a
./scripts/feeds install -a
cp .config_pine64_pinedio_lora_gw .config
make

OpenWrt Project is a Linux operating system targeting embedded devices. Instead of trying to create a single, static firmware, OpenWrt provides a fully writable filesystem with package management. This frees you from the application selection and configuration provided by the vendor and allows you to customize the device through the use of packages to suit any application. For developers, OpenWrt is the framework to build an application without having to build a complete firmware around it; for users this means the ability for full customization, to use the device in ways never envisioned.

To build your own firmware you need a GNU/Linux, BSD or MacOSX system (case sensitive filesystem required). Cygwin is unsupported because of the lack of a case sensitive file system.

Requirements

You need the following tools to compile OpenWrt, the package names vary between distributions. A complete list with distribution specific packages is found in the Build System Setup documentation.

binutils bzip2 diff find flex gawk gcc-6+ getopt grep install libc-dev libz-dev
make4.1+ perl python3.6+ rsync subversion unzip which

Quickstart

  1. Run ./scripts/feeds update -a to obtain all the latest package definitions defined in feeds.conf / feeds.conf.default

  2. Run ./scripts/feeds install -a to install symlinks for all obtained packages into package/feeds/

  3. Run make menuconfig to select your preferred configuration for the toolchain, target system & firmware packages.

  4. Run make to build your firmware. This will download all sources, build the cross-compile toolchain and then cross-compile the GNU/Linux kernel & all chosen applications for your target system.
